The UNI Hardee's

Posting this week's photo of the week has caused me to think about my days of working at the Hardee's in the Maucker union on the campus of the University of Northern Iowa. For most of the time I was a student at UNI, I worked at that Hardee's. There was a semester or two when I was fed up with it that I did not work there, but I kept going back. I don't know what it was about that place, but I had some good times working there. The thing that I think kept drawing me back was the people I worked with. Being a fast food restaurant we had a pretty high rate of turnover, and I'm sure having college students for employees didn't help, but there were quite a few employees who remained the same during the five years I was a student on the UNI campus.

Working at the UNI Hardee's during the summer was fairly fun. It wasn't too busy, except for when there was a summer orientation group on campus, and the hours weren't too bad. Because it wasn't too busy, we would sometimes watch an episode of Star Trek on the VCR in the office. Once the episode was over, Mike, Julie, and I would take the quiz from the Star Trek Quiz Book that I had. That was a lot of fun.
